Crocus City Hall Attack: Death Toll Rises To 137

Russian authorities have raised the death toll from Friday’s mass shooting at the Crocus City Hall to 137 people, including three children, up from an earlier estimate of 133,

The Investigation Committee disclosed that 62 bodies have been identified.

This came as Russia observed a national day of mourning.

According to state news agency, events at cultural institutions were canceled, flags were lowered, and TV entertainment and ads were suspended.

People brought flowers to a makeshift memorial near the burnt-out concert hall.

The news agency added that suspects in the Crocus City Hall shooting were brought to the Investigation Committee’s headquarters in Moscow.

Russia’s Investigative Committee also announced that guns and rounds of ammunition had been found both there and in a car that was used by the suspected gunmen to flee the scene.

The agency posted a video of the four suspects being dragged into its headquarters in Moscow.

There was no statement on the other seven suspects arrested in connection with the attack. Officials have not named the shooters, but said they were all foreign nationals.

Meanwhile, more than 5,000 people have donated blood to those injured in the attack, with many reportedly standing in long queues outside clinics.

Islamic State has claimed responsibility for Friday’s massacre, but there has since been indications that Russia was pursuing a Ukrainian link despite Kyiv’s insistence Ukraine had no involvement in the attack.

Islamic State released new videos of the attack on the Crocus City concert hall outside Moscow that left 133 people dead, corroborating the terror group’s claim to have masterminded the slaughter even as Russia has sought to place the blame on Ukraine, which Kyiv denies.

The videos, which were published by IS’s news agency, showed the gunmen filming themselves as they hunted concertgoers through the lobby of the Crocus City Hall and fired at them from pointblank range, killing scores of people.

At one point, one of the gunmen tells another to “kill them and have no mercy.”

White House Affirms Ukraine’s Non-Involvement In Concert Hall Attack

Also on Sunday, the White House asserted that Ukraine had “no involvement whatsoever” in the attack in the Moscow concert hall that killed at least 137 people.

Using an acronym for the Islamic State group, which has claimed responsibility for the attack, White House national security council spokesperson, Adrienne Watson, stated, “ISIS bears sole responsibility for this attack. There was no Ukrainian involvement whatsoever.”

Watson added that a few weeks ago, the U.S government shared information with Russia about a planned attack in Moscow and issued a public advisory to Americans in Russia on March 7, 2024.

Additionally, the U.S Vice President, Kamala Harris, said in an interview that there was “no” evidence that Ukraine was involved.

 “ISIS-K is actually, by all accounts, responsible for what happened,” she said.

The “K” refers to Khorasan, IS’s branch in Afghanistan and Pakistan.

Meanwhile, Russian foreign ministry spokesperson, Maria Zakharova, disregarded the US intelligence reports saying that the Islamic State group was behind the Moscow concert hall attack.

“I wish they could have solved the assassination of their own President Kennedy so quickly,” she wrote on Telegram.

She added, “But no, for more than 60 years they have not been able to find out who killed him after all. Or maybe that was ISIS too?

“Until the investigation into the terrorist attack at Crocus City Hall is completed, any phrase from Washington exonerating Kyiv should be considered as evidence.

“After all, the financing of terrorist activities of the Kyiv organised criminal group by the American liberal democrats and participation in the corrupt schemes of the Biden family have been going on for many years.”

Kyiv has vociferously denied any links to the attack and has indicated it believes Moscow is preparing a pretext to escalate the conflict.
